Harling House is a former warehouse property that has been converted to provide offices. The offices benefit from classic warehouse featurees with high ceilings and large windows providing excellent natural light.
It is the intention of our clients to refurbish the offices to provide open plan accommodation that will benefit from raised floors, air-cooling and lighting suspended from the exposed ceiling.
Location
The property is prominently located at the junction of Great Suffolk Street and Union Street.
Transport links are excellent with Harling House being mid-way between Waterloo and London Bridge Stations. Southwark Underground station (Jubilee Line) is approximately 3 minutes' walk from the building.
There are numerous amenities within a very short walk including several quality restaurants, cafes and shops. On the ground floor is the recently opened Union Street Cafe by Gordon Ramsey.
